Chaplain Resident
Job Description Summary
The Chaplain Resident participates in the Clinical Pastoral Education Program and provides spiritual care and support to patients, families, and staff across OhioHealth facilities.
Responsibilities And Duties
- 50% Fully participates in the Clinical Pastoral Education Program, meeting all course requirements on time.
- 15% Provides ongoing spiritual care, prayer, sacramental ministry, and assists with patient education and advance directives.
- 15% Shares rotation of "on-call" responsibilities as needed.
- 5% Participates in interdisciplinary teams and hospital-wide committees.
- 5% Attends staff meetings and educational retreats.
- 5% Supports the system's deceased care program, including grief counseling and assisting with paperwork.
- 2% Serves as a liaison between local clergy, patients, families, and staff.
- 1% Supports policy development, strategic planning, and evaluation of the Pastoral Care Department.
- 2% Assists in organizing workshops, lectures, and other events.
- 1% Shares responsibilities for providing various worship services, including memorial services.
